The 5/3 thing assumes you're pure STR, for simplicity's sake. So if you are pure STR (meaning 0 DEX, somehow), it'll be completely accurate. Most chars have enough STR compared to DEX that it'll get a reasonable estimate. But if you're really high DEX, it won't work that way.

EmuAlert Wrote:@ Stereo: so, more roughly, it takes the top 3/5 and bottom 3/5 of your range?
No.

EmuAlert Wrote:I can't believe a formula that has been around since beta still plagues us.
Not at all, actually. You can definitely get exact results by using the damage formula, which has long been known (the one I've posted above, and Dusk used in his calculations). It's the issue of conveniently estimating from a given damage range that's being discussed, which in most reasonable cases works using Joe's 5/3 rule. You can contrive a situation to throw it off, but it's a moot point anyway because it's not supposed to be 100% accurate. Just handy and relatively easy to do.

TobiasBlack Wrote:the day i, a 9x dk, use PA fury and hit over 9k

Only takes a base range around 3600 on Snails... if we had the new Cygnus Blessing, my 94 DK could be hitting 9400s with Warrior Elixirs and 9900 with Ciders. Level to 95 and the str increase would be enough to break 10k, let alone finding a decent Red Surfboard. As it stands, with 0 blessing I can do 9200 with Cider.


The only possible use of PA Crusher I've managed to think of is that since it hits 3 times, you roll the dice 3 times on accuracy. Less likely to miss completely. Now I just need to find where that would be useful...
